Available at parker.com/gsfe Simple guidelines for the selection of purification equipment 1. Purification equipment is installed to provide air quality, therefore you must first of all identify the quality of compressed air required for the compressed air leaving the compressor room and for each point of use on the compressed air system. 2. The air quality required at each point of use may differ dependent upon the application. 3. Using the quality classifications shown in ISO8573-1 will allow easy selection of purification equipment. 4. ISO8573-1:2010 is the latest edition of the standard, however some facilities may still be operating on older revisions. 5. Specifying air quality as ISO8573-1, ISO8573-1:1991 or ISO8573-1:2001 refers to the previous editions of the standard and may result in a different quality of delivered compressed air. 6. Ensure any ISO8573-1 air purity classifications are written in full and include the revision year to allow for correct product selection. 7. Remember - Oil-free compressor installations require the same filtration considerations as oil lubricated compressor installations.
